About Tae Heon Kim
Tae Heon Kim is a scholar working on Urology, Rheumatology and Otorhinolaryngology, having authored 72 papers that have together received 1.0k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Pelvic floor disorders treatments (20 papers), Urinary Bladder and Prostate Research (19 papers) and Prostate Cancer Diagnosis and Treatment (15 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Urology (324 citations), Sensory Systems (119 citations) and Rheumatology (274 citations). Tae Heon Kim has collaborated with scholars based in South Korea, United States and Japan. Frequent co-authors include Kyu‐Sung Lee, Deok Hyun Han, Seong Soo Jeon, Byong Chang Jeong, Seong Il Seo, Yoon Seok Suh, Hwang Gyun Jeon, Dong Kuk Ahn, Yong Chul Bae and Koichi Noguchi. Their work appears in journals such as SHILAP Revista de lepidopterología, PLoS ONE and The Journal of Comparative Neurology.
